Transaction 0872774bdeb07d16f6db5d39d0f7c615058a228c255a93f4c1548ff4ad903f96

3 Input
2 Outputs
  • 0872774bdeb07d16f6db5d39d0f7c615058a228c255a93f4c1548ff4ad903f96:0
  • value  31306
    address  1Cd8K5NEC6mC2e8fGdXN5EEVNdbjxhMVeE
  • 0872774bdeb07d16f6db5d39d0f7c615058a228c255a93f4c1548ff4ad903f96:1
  • value  2564989
    address  31wmXP2Pfmyi7hCYhnE2XaC4cwLwQcc496